Jan van Goyen’s View of the Rhine with Men in Boats, the Town of Rhenen Beyond (1636) captures the serene yet dynamic essence of Dutch Golden Age landscape painting. Under a dramatic, cloud-filled sky, the Rhine River unfolds with subtle gradations of light, where tiny boats and figures animate the tranquil waters. Rhenen’s distant silhouette, rendered in warm earthen tones, contrasts with the cool, atmospheric expanse, embodying van Goyen’s mastery of tonal realism and his innovative use of muted color palettes. As a pioneer of the tonal phase of Dutch landscape art, van Goyen elevated everyday scenes into poetic reflections of nature’s transient beauty. This work exemplifies his ability to balance topographical precision with evocative mood, securing his legacy as a bridge between impressionistic spontaneity and classical composition. Its historical significance lies in its departure from idealized landscapes, embracing instead the humble, wind-swept charm of the Netherlands.
